首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CodenameOne编码的HTML字符串

CodenameOne是一个跨平台的移动应用开发框架,它允许开发人员使用Java语言编写一次代码,然后将其转换为原生的iOS、Android、Windows Phone和其他平台的应用程序。CodenameOne提供了丰富的API和工具,使开发人员能够轻松地构建功能强大、高性能的移动应用。

HTML字符串是一种包含HTML标记和内容的字符串。它可以用于在网页中动态生成和展示HTML内容,也可以用于在移动应用中显示富文本内容。通过将HTML字符串插入到应用程序的UI组件中,可以实现各种样式和布局效果。

CodenameOne提供了一个HTMLComponent组件,可以用于在应用程序中显示HTML字符串。开发人员可以使用CodenameOne的API将HTML字符串加载到HTMLComponent中,并将其添加到应用程序的用户界面中。HTMLComponent支持常见的HTML标记和样式,可以实现富文本内容的展示。

优势:

  1. 跨平台:CodenameOne允许开发人员使用一套代码构建适用于多个平台的应用程序,大大减少了开发和维护的工作量。
  2. 高性能:CodenameOne的应用程序是原生的,可以获得与原生应用程序相当的性能和响应速度。
  3. 丰富的API和工具:CodenameOne提供了许多API和工具,使开发人员能够轻松地实现各种功能和效果。
  4. 简化的开发流程:使用CodenameOne,开发人员可以使用熟悉的Java语言进行开发,无需学习其他语言或平台特定的技术。

应用场景:

  1. 移动应用开发:CodenameOne适用于开发各种类型的移动应用程序,包括商业应用、社交媒体应用、游戏等。
  2. 富文本展示:通过在应用程序中使用HTMLComponent,开发人员可以轻松地展示富文本内容,包括格式化文本、图像、链接等。
  3. 动态内容生成:开发人员可以使用CodenameOne动态生成HTML字符串,以便在应用程序中显示动态内容,如新闻、博客等。

推荐的腾讯云相关产品: 腾讯云提供了一系列与移动应用开发和云计算相关的产品和服务,以下是一些推荐的产品: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行CodenameOne应用程序。
  2. 云数据库MySQL版:提供高性能、可扩展的关系型数据库服务,用于存储和管理应用程序的数据。
  3. 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理应用程序的静态资源,如图片、音视频文件等。
  4. 人工智能服务:腾讯云提供了一系列人工智能服务,如语音识别、图像识别等,可以与CodenameOne应用程序集成,实现更智能的功能。

更多腾讯云产品和产品介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券